Crafting a Compelling Curriculum Vitae (CV)

A well-structured and detailed CV is your copyright to landing your dream job. Initiate by outlining your work experience in reverse chronological order, highlighting achievements and quantifiable results. Adapt your CV for each application, leveraging keywords from the job description to demonstrate your suitability. A clear skills section demonstrates your proficiency in relevant areas. Finally, proofread meticulously for any errors to ensure a professional final product.

Building the Perfect CV Structure: A Guide to Model CVs

A well-structured Curriculum Vitae is your key to grabbing the attention of hiring managers. It highlights your qualifications in a clear and structured manner, permitting them to quickly understand your worth. There are several popular CV structures that you can employ, each with its own benefits.

  • Reverse Chronological structure is a time-honored format that presents your work experience in starting with the most recent role, highlighting your career progression.
  • Functional structure prioritizes on your abilities, grouping them by area. This format is particularly appropriate if you have gaps in your employment history or are transitioning careers.
  • Integrated structure combines elements of both reverse chronological and competency structures, delivering a detailed overview of your background.

Ultimately, the best CV structure for you is contingent on your individual circumstances and objectives. Carefully consider your capabilities and target audience when making your selection.
